Key Insights Summary

The UB Ultra U.S. Treasury Bond Futures weekly chart shows a market in transition. Price action is currently around 120'14, with medium-sized bars and average momentum, indicating neither strong buying nor selling pressure. The short-term Weekly Session Fib Grid (WSFG) trend is down, with price below the NTZ center, but the swing pivot trend is up, creating a mixed short-term outlook. Intermediate-term signals are more constructive: both the Monthly Session Fib Grid (MSFG) and swing HiLo trend are up, supported by recent long trade signals and upward-trending 5- and 10-week moving averages. Long-term, the Yearly Session Fib Grid (YSFG) trend is up, but major resistance from the 100- and 200-week moving averages remains overhead, and price is still well below these levels. Key resistance levels are clustered far above current price, while support is found at 119'16.875 and 111'56.250. The market appears to be in a broad consolidation phase, with potential for further upside if intermediate-term momentum persists, but significant overhead resistance and mixed short-term signals suggest a cautious, range-bound environment.
